Overview""The Timbering of Metalliferous Mines"" is a comprehensive technical manual dedicated to the essential structural practices required for safe and efficient underground mining. This work serves as an authoritative guide on the selection, preparation, and installation of timber supports within various types of metal mines. The text meticulously details the mechanical principles of ground pressure and the practical methods used to counteract the immense forces encountered in deep-level excavations. The book covers a wide array of topics, including the properties of different wood species, methods of framing, and the specific requirements for shaft timbering, level sets, and stope supports. By focusing on the challenges unique to metalliferous deposits, the author provides invaluable insights into the engineering solutions of the early 20th century. Its focus on practical application makes it an essential resource for mining engineers, geologists, and students of industrial history.
